Responsibilities:

JOB PURPOSE

The job purpose of an Office Executive is to effectively manage and optimize operational processes to ensure the smooth functioning of the organization, maximize efficiency, and contribute to the achievement of business goals.

P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Collaborate with the programme planning team to develop comprehensive logistical plans for various programmes, taking into account timelines, resources, and participant requirements etc.
  • Coordinate all logistical arrangements, including venue selection, transportation, accommodation, and catering, ensuring they align with programme objectives and budgetary constraints.
  • Manage the scheduling of programme activities, including meetings, workshops, and training sessions, ensuring optimal allocation of resources and adherence to established timelines.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for external vendors, negotiating contracts, managing relationships, and coordinating their services to ensure seamless program execution.
  • Develop and maintain detailed logistical documentation, including event schedules, participant lists, and resource requirements, to facilitate effective communication and coordination.
  • Monitor and track program expenses related to logistics, ensuring adherence to budgetary guidelines and making recommendations for cost optimization where possible.
  • Coordinate travel arrangements for programme participants, for example booking flights, accommodations, and transportation, and providing necessary information and support.
  • Liaise with internal stakeholders, such as programme managers, trainers, and support staff, to ensure smooth coordination and timely delivery of logistical requirements.
  • Conduct post-programme evaluation of logistical operations, identifying areas for improvement and implementing corrective measures for future programmes.Stay updated on industry trends and best practices in logistical planning, recommending innovative solutions to enhance efficiency and effectiveness.
